    Senior Substation Project Engineer

    Job Summary

    POWER Engineers is currently seeking a senior level electrical engineer with substation design experience to work as a Substation Project Engineer in the Power Delivery Substation Department in our Ann Arbor, Michigan office. Flexibility is available for a hybrid work environment (employee will need to live within driving distance of the office).

    Roles and Responsibilities

    • Grow and manage relationships with local clients.

    • Mentor less experienced staff in substation project execution.

    • Perform and direct others in the detailed design of medium to extra high voltage utility substations including one-line diagrams, three line diagrams, AC/DC schematics, elementary and wiring diagrams, SCADA, communications, conduit and cable sizing/routing, substation physical layouts, selection of substation equipment, writing of substation equipment specifications, proposal development, construction cost estimates, and project scheduling.

    • Ensure POWER quality procedures are followed and that the team is resourced in an optimal manner.

    • Perform QA/QC for deliverables to clients across multiple offices.

    • Manage all schedule, budget, and quality of assigned projects.

    Required Education/Experience

    • Ability to function as a Senior Substation Project Engineer in the Ann Arbor location of our Substation Business Unit.

    • BSEE (BS Electrical Engineering) or BSEET (BS Electrical Engineering Technology) from an accredited university.

    • Professional Engineering license (PE) or ability to obtain within one year.

    • Experience in 15kV through 345kV physical and electrical substation design, and IEEE/ANSI standards.

    • Experience in managing 5 or more people on a project team.

    • Experience filling the role of project engineer for several projects occurring concurrently.

    • The candidate must have strong command of the English language with good written and oral communication skills in order to work effectively with internal team members and external client personnel.

    • Candidates must be legally authorized to work permanently in the U.S. without the need for work sponsorship.

    Desired Education/Experience

    • Ten or more years experience in utility substation design.

    • Experience with and established positive relationships with local clients.

    • Experience in 345kV through 500 kV substation design.
